GNCAccountType
xaccAccountTypeGetFundamental (GNCAccountType t)
{
switch (t)
{
case ACCT_TYPE_BANK:
case ACCT_TYPE_STOCK:
case ACCT_TYPE_MUTUAL:
case ACCT_TYPE_CURRENCY:
case ACCT_TYPE_CASH:
case ACCT_TYPE_ASSET:
case ACCT_TYPE_RECEIVABLE:
return ACCT_TYPE_ASSET;
case ACCT_TYPE_CREDIT:
case ACCT_TYPE_LIABILITY:
case ACCT_TYPE_PAYABLE:
return ACCT_TYPE_LIABILITY;
case ACCT_TYPE_INCOME:
return ACCT_TYPE_INCOME;
case ACCT_TYPE_EXPENSE:
return ACCT_TYPE_EXPENSE;
case ACCT_TYPE_EQUITY:
return ACCT_TYPE_EQUITY;
case ACCT_TYPE_TRADING:
default:
return ACCT_TYPE_NONE;
}
}
